Description

"Oil painting on canvas with the image of Duchess Marie Sophie Wilhelmine of Württemberg - Oels.

Wife of the last reigning Duke of Württemberg-Oels; Karl Christian Erdmann von Württemberg-Oels (1716–1792). At the bottom right there is the name "REGNAULT 1760". However, it is assumed that it is a work by Johann Georg Ziesenis the Elder. J. (* 1716 in Copenhagen; † March 4, 1776 in Hanover). He was a German portrait painter. He comes from a family of artisans and artists from the 17th and 18th centuries, whose works are attributed to the Hanoverian Rococo. The size with frame is 97 x 81 cm. Without frame 79 x 62 cm. The painting has been lined and professionally restored. The frame is included as a gift."
